A 3 in 1 MIG Welder combines MIG, TIG, and ARC welding capabilities in a single unit, providing versatility for a wide range of metal fabrication tasks. Instead of maintaining separate machines for each welding type, a single 3 in 1 MIG Welding Machine allows operators to switch between processes depending on the material and project requirements. This versatility is particularly useful in small workshops or for mobile welding tasks, where space and equipment costs are limited. By integrating multiple functions, these machines reduce setup time and simplify workflow, making welding operations more efficient.
Benefits of Using a MIG TIG ARC Welder
A MIG TIG ARC Welder provides flexibility that traditional single-process welders cannot match. MIG welding is suitable for fast, high-volume work and is commonly used for steel and aluminum. TIG welding offers precise, clean welds, ideal for stainless steel or thinner materials. ARC welding is useful for outdoor applications and thicker metals, where portability and robustness are important. Having all three functions in one machine enables operators to adapt quickly to different tasks without needing to switch machines, improving productivity and reducing downtime.
Space and Cost Efficiency
One of the practical advantages of a 3 in 1 MIG Welder is the space savings it provides. Workshops no longer need to dedicate floor space to multiple machines, allowing more room for fabrication, storage, or assembly. Additionally, a 3 in 1 MIG Welding Machine reduces equipment costs, as investing in a single multi-function unit is often less expensive than purchasing three separate welders. Maintenance and consumable management also become simpler, since operators deal with one power source and set of controls rather than multiple systems.
